8-Hour Turkey Stew Recipe
|
This 8-Hour Turkey Stew recipe is for a crockpot.
What You Need
3 cups potatoes, peeled and cubed
2 cups mushrooms, quartered
1 1/2 cups carrots, chopped
1 cup onion, chopped
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on ground thyme
1 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
2 pounds boneless, skinless turkey breast, cubed
2 tablespoon all purpose flour
1/2 cup dry white wine
1/2 cup low-sodium reduced-fat chicken broth
1 1/2 tablespoon tomato paste
1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
What To Do
1. Combine vegetables and spices in a large crockpot.
2. Rinse turkey cubes and pat dry, then coat with flour. Add to crockpot over top of vegetables.
3. Mix wine, broth, tomato paste and Worcestershire and pour over turkey.
4. Cover and cook on low for eight hours. Stir once or twice during last hour only to break apart any turkey cubes that are stuck together. Don't leave the lid off for long.
5. Stir in parsley just before serving.
